Very quickly, my solar battery storage system changed the way I use electricity at home. Before installation, I was sending most of my solar power back to the grid during the day, then buying expensive power in the evening. That felt especially wasteful in winter, when our heat pump runs after sunset.

I chose a 10 kWh home battery paired with my rooftop solar panels and hybrid inverter. The pack uses EVE MB31 cells, which was one reason I felt comfortable with the purchase. The installer mounted it in our garage and finished the wiring in a day. The setup itself was less dramatic than I expected: the app found the inverter, showed state of charge, and let me set a reserve level. I kept that reserve at 20 percent so we would still have backup power during an outage.

The biggest difference appears between 4 and 9 p.m. My utility's time-of-use rate is highest then, so the battery discharges while we cook, run the dishwasher, and watch TV. On sunny days, the panels fill the battery by early afternoon. Instead of exporting that cheap solar energy, I use it later at the expensive rate.

My monthly bill dropped from roughly $180 in summer to $70–$90, depending on air-conditioning. That is not a perfect zero-dollar bill, but the battery has paid for itself gradually through peak-hour savings rather than optimistic promises.

I did have one minor scare during the first month. The battery stopped discharging at 48 percent, even though the app showed plenty of solar energy earlier that day. I checked the inverter and found a backup reserve setting had accidentally been raised after a firmware update. The installer reset it remotely, and normal cycling resumed that evening. Since then, I monitor it weekly, and the results remain reassuring daily.
